Sadly, this property is not what it use to be
Pros:

As a Hilton Lifetime Diamond Member, I've been going to this Hilton for at least 15 yrs, even when it was a Hilton Garden Inn,  Sadly, this property and the service have gone downhill since new ownership took over in the last 1-2 yrs. The last few times that I have stayed at this property, we've booked a King Suite corner room which are spacious rooms. Unfortunately, both times that we've checked into our room, the room reeks of pet disinfectant, no doubt because of the number of dogs staying there. The smell for so bad, we had to close our bedroom door and cover our noses while sleeping. At one point it felt like we were staying in a Pet Hotel, instead of a regular hotel. If you're going to cater to Pet owners, remember that the majority of your guests don't travel with pets. Secondly, the ice machine on our floor was not working, so we went to the 3rd floor where there was a mildewed towel on the floor in front of the ice machine, where it was leaking water. The microwave next to the ice machine had not been cleaned and had some molded food on the microwave tray.  At one time this hotel had an executive lounge, unfortunately, they closed that 4-5 yrs ago. On our 1st full day for breakfast, we had to wait 17-20 mins because one server called out sick.  When we were there in Jan 26, there was no breakfast buffet one day because it was "Off Season".  Finally, since the COVID years, housekeeping at hotels has been a joke, and this Hilton is no exception. If I'm paying $500-$600 a night for a room, YES, I want housekeeping, unless I tell you otherwise! I should not have to check in at the front desk every morning to see if our name is on the housekeeping list. I personally think this property should go back to just being a HGI, cause at this point they're masquerading as a full service Hilton

Worse stay ever for a Hilton
Pros:

I am currently waiting 1/2 compensation after calling Hilton guest customer service. I stayed there a Wednesday -Friday in February. Arriving late Wednesday, I noticed right away mold on the bottom shower, yellow on flat pillows, and while the toiletries (shampoo, conditioner, bath wash) hung in the shower, on the counter only had a cheap bar of soap and shower cap. The website said premium toiletries. Valet service was $51, that the hotel said they are not affiliated to. While there was a park and pay across the street for $22 a night, for some reason it would not work for me any hours after midnight.
The next day staying there (Thursday), at 5 p.m. I returned to my room to find it unmade. I did not understand why. I called the front desk for clean towels so I could shower since mine were on the floor, still wet and musty. The towels finally arrived 7:40 at night.
Friday afternoon (third day) I stopped into the hotel room at 3:30 p.m. The room was STILL unmade. I went to the front desk to complain. The front desk (John B.) said the maids were already gone for the day and they were also short of maids. The hotel was also currently only making guest rooms every three days (the other front receptionist said five days) unless guest request. I NEVER WAS INFORMED/NOR TURNED DOWN SERVICE for room cleaning. My room remained unmade the ENTIRE time and because of mold, smelled.
As a hotel guest I pay not just for a place to sleep, but for a comfy and enjoyable clean environment. I believe this was a violation of OSHA and CDC best practices. I complained at the front desk twice, I waited for a manager, but that became an inconvenience since I was working at a conference nearby and could not keep waiting. They never reached out to me. Upon checking out with complaint again, the front desk handed me a Trip Advisor card with their hotel on it to complain instead of resolving, hence calling Hilton customer service. It has been four days with slow compensation of any sort.
